Output 65a23e9654a2d8664215df94eb544b85dfe264b8481a999fbb81fe4d45e4dd38:3

value
994983
script pubkey
OP_0 OP_PUSHBYTES_20 5d3707b0884f0aed9bec3d2ea56527fdecb34907
address
ltc1qt5ms0vygfu9wmxlv85h22ef8lhktxjg8aeu2vn
transaction
65a23e9654a2d8664215df94eb544b85dfe264b8481a999fbb81fe4d45e4dd38
spent
true